# Since get_user_model() causes a circular import if called when app models are
# being loaded, the user_model_label should be used when possible, with calls
# to get_user_model deferred to execution time

user_model_label = getattr(settings, 'AUTH_USER_MODEL', 'auth.User')


def get_user_model_path():
    """
    Returns 'app_label.ModelName' for User model. Basically if
    ``AUTH_USER_MODEL`` is set at settings it would be returned, otherwise
    ``auth.User`` is returned.
    """
    return getattr(settings, 'AUTH_USER_MODEL', 'auth.User')


def get_user_permission_full_codename(perm):
    """
    Returns 'app_label.<perm>_<usermodulename>'. If standard ``auth.User`` is
    used, for 'change' perm this would return ``auth.change_user`` and if
    ``myapp.CustomUser`` is used it would return ``myapp.change_customuser``.
    """
    User = get_user_model()
    model_name = User._meta.model_name
    return '{}.{}_{}'.format(User._meta.app_label, perm, model_name)


def get_user_permission_codename(perm):
    """
    Returns '<perm>_<usermodulename>'. If standard ``auth.User`` is
    used, for 'change' perm this would return ``change_user`` and if
    ``myapp.CustomUser`` is used it would return ``change_customuser``.
    """
    return get_user_permission_full_codename(perm).split('.')[1]
